# Practical Applications: Diving into Real-World Scenarios
The true value of this certificate program lies in its practical applications. The curriculum is designed to equip you with the skills needed to tackle real-world tax challenges. One key area of focus is international tax law, which is increasingly relevant in today's globalized economy. You'll learn about transfer pricing, controlled foreign corporations (CFCs), and the intricacies of cross-border transactions.
Real-world case studies are integral to this section. For example, you might study the tax implications of a multinational corporation's operations in different jurisdictions. This could involve analyzing how tax treaties affect the company's tax liabilities and exploring strategies to optimize tax efficiency while ensuring compliance. By dissecting these complex scenarios, you'll gain a deeper understanding of how tax laws interact with business strategies.
